    Weatherstripping

    Weatherstripping can help reduce drafts that may be able to enter your home through windows and doors, thereby helping to reduce costs for cooling and heating. It also helps keep cool air out in summer and warm air inside in winter.

    There are a variety of weatherstripping each designed to close specific gaps and cracks in your doors and windows. The type of weatherstripping you choose will depend on your needs, the size and shape of your window or door and the design of your windows and frames.

    Foam tape, which is composed of either open-cell foam or EPDM rubber with a sticky backing, is the most commonly used weather stripping to seal gaps. It is available in various widths and thicknesses to suit cracks that are irregular in size.

    V-strips, which fold into an 'V'-shaped shape to bridge gaps, are ideal to seal the sides of sliding or double-hung windows as well as on the top and bottom of doors. They can be either self-adhesive, or attached with screws.

    Door sweeps are flat pieces of aluminum, plastic or stainless steel. They are equipped with a strip or vinyl to cover the space between the threshold and the door. They're a popular choice to close the gap between the inner and outside sides of doors. They are easy to put in and less costly than other door-stripping alternatives.

    Metal weatherstripping, which is able to be customized to fit the windows' sashes, is another great option for sealing gaps around the sashes of your windows. It helps prevent condensation from developing on the glass. This is a problem in older homes with wooden windows and sashes.

    Magnetic weatherstripping can be another good option for sealing the top and sides of a door. It works in the same way as refrigerator gaskets and makes a perfect fit between the door frame and.

    This type of weatherstripping can be quite costly, especially when you're required to purchase several rolls. It is best to hire an expert to install it.
